What causes yellow plasma
Icterus (liver cant get bilirubin out of blood from hemolysis)
Normal plasma color
clear to light amber
What four factors may result in a hemolyzed serum/ plasma
- Improper storage
- Inadequate centrifugation
- Mechanical damage
- Temperature
What are three possible causes of lipemia (white/ turbid)
- Diabetes
- Post prandial
- Pancreatitis
Hematocrit/ PCV
RBC mass in the blood
Its important to do _______ readings of PCV/ hematocrit in the case of blood loss or dehydration, why
Serial readings
bc lab values for pcv will not reflect blood/ volume loss in the first six hours
What is vWf
a glycoprotein that helps platelet adhesion during primary hemostasis
What happens during primary hemostasis
Platelet plug formation
BMBT
Buccal Mucosal Bleeding Time
Three platelet counting methods
- Manual (hemocytometer)
- Flow cytometry
- Impedance
